Firstly, understanding the technology behind MOSFET (Metal-Oxide-Semiconductor Field-Effect Transistor) inverters is crucial. These devices contribute to compact designs and higher efficiency in welding processes compared to older transformer-based models. MOSFET inverters provide excellent control over the welding arc, resulting in smoother and cleaner welds, particularly important for more delicate applications and materials.
When assessing which MOSFET inverter TIG welder to purchase, the first key point to consider is the machine's duty cycle. The duty cycle indicates how long the welder can operate continuously before needing to cool down. A higher duty cycle allows for longer, uninterrupted welding sessions, making it especially important for professionals who require reliability during extensive work. Look for models with a duty cycle rating of at least 60%, as this will facilitate more productive sessions.
Another vital feature is the output range. The best MOSFET inverter TIG welders provide adjustable output settings, allowing users to work with various materials and thicknesses. This versatility is invaluable for individuals or businesses dealing with a variety of welding projects. Look for machines that offer a wide range, typically between 10 to 250 amps, which allows adaptability across materials like aluminum, steel, and thin sheet metals.
Portability and design also play a considerable role in the purchasing decision. Many users prefer lightweight and compact welders that are easy to transport without sacrificing performance. Thus, if you're often on the move or work in tight spaces, look for models with robust carrying cases or integrated designs that facilitate portability.
Additionally, consider the brand's reputation and customer service. Established brands tend to offer better after-sales support, availability of replacement parts, and warranties, which significantly affect the long-term cost and operational reliability of the machine. Models from reputable manufacturers such as Everlast, AHP, and Miller Electric are often recommended due to their performance reliability and customer support standards.
Inversely, be cautious with lesser-known brands. While they might offer attractive prices, inadequate support and potential maintenance issues can lead to unexpected costs in the future. Always seek out user reviews and testimonies when evaluating lesser-known options. Fellow welders can provide insights into reliability and effectiveness that aren’t always obvious from product descriptions or manufacturer claims.
One emerging trend is the increasing emphasis on inverter technology that incorporates advanced features. Some welders now come equipped with digital displays and microprocessor controls, allowing users to fine-tune settings for precise welding. These modern enhancements can lead to less trial and error, making the learning curve for new users less steep.
